LAKE, Eleanor B. of Saginaw, Michigan passed away Tuesday, December 28, 2010 at the Masonic Pathways, Alma, Michigan, age 83 years. Eleanor B. Baillie was born December 6, 1927 in North Tonawanda, New York to the late Thomas K. and Matilda Florence Baillie. She married Charles A. Lake, Jr....
